In this way, Is Coca-Cola a bad company?

Since the 1990s Coca-Cola has been accused of unethical behavior in a number of areas, in- cluding product safety, anti-competitiveness, racial discrimination, channel stuffing, dis- tributor conflicts, intimidation of union workers, pollution, depletion of natural resources, and health concerns.

Is Coca-Cola owned by China?

The Coca-Cola system in China is currently investing $4 billion locally for future growth from 2015 to 2017, building on $9 billion of investments made in the market since 1979. … When the transaction is complete, COFCO will own and operate 18 bottling plants, and Swire will own and operate 17 in Mainland China.

How many Cokes a day is safe?

However, you would need to drink more than six 12-ounce (355-ml) cans of Coke or four 12-ounce (355-ml) cans of Diet Coke per day to reach this amount. 400 mg of caffeine daily is considered safe for most adults, but cutting your intake to 200 mg daily can help reduce your risk of adverse side effects.

Why is Coke better than Pepsi?

Coca-Cola, nutritionally, has a touch more sodium than Pepsi, which reminds us of Topo Chico or a club soda and results in a less blatantly sweet taste. Pepsi packs more calories, sugar, and caffeine than Coke. … “Pepsi is sweeter than Coke, so right away it had a big advantage in a sip test.

Do Coke own Pepsi?

The Coca-Cola Company (Coke) and Pepsico (Pepsi) are separate publicly traded companies. Coke trades under the stock symbol KO and Pepsi trades under PEP. The two companies are the main competitors in the soda market and have been for several decades.

Is Gatorade just as bad as soda?

A 20-ounce serving of Gatorade’s Thirst Quencher contains 36 grams of sugar. While that’s a bit less sugar per ounce than your average soda, it’s not exactly healthy. In fact, Berkeley researchers say the sugar in sports drinks may be contributing to the child obesity epidemic by increasing caloric intake.

How many cans of Mountain Dew will kill me?

So, for Mountain Dew to be lethal for 50% of the population, assuming you weigh 180 pounds/80 kilos, in one sitting you’d need to drink about 275 cans for the caffeine, 30 cans for the sugar, or about 18 cans for the water.
